Transaction 2373074fc290e6377ce13ccab0313afdd7b46ec05e3be1522c3a12867e9768a8
1 Input
1 Output
-
2373074fc290e6377ce13ccab0313afdd7b46ec05e3be1522c3a12867e9768a8:0
- value
- 177066
- script pubkey
- OP_0 OP_PUSHBYTES_32 1a45e82ea2ada5c627bb992d1f4f7ac9aec8e7102a2672774c5d4ca06b5601d8
- address
- bc1qrfz7st4z4kjuvfamnyk37nm6exhv3ecs9gn8ya6vt4x2q66kq8vqufnrkj